diff --git a/src/main/java/mx/gob/jumapacelaya/ui/ActDiariaView.java b/src/main/java/mx/gob/jumapacelaya/ui/ActDiariaView.java index 7d166d0..86ed2fb 100644 --- a/src/main/java/mx/gob/jumapacelaya/ui/ActDiariaView.java +++ b/src/main/java/mx/gob/jumapacelaya/ui/ActDiariaView.java @@ -1,15 +1,63 @@ package mx.gob.jumapacelaya.ui; +import com.vaadin.flow.component.Unit; +import com.vaadin.flow.component.checkbox.CheckboxGroup; +import com.vaadin.flow.component.combobox.ComboBox; +import com.vaadin.flow.component.datepicker.DatePicker; +import com.vaadin.flow.component.formlayout.FormLayout; +import com.vaadin.flow.component.grid.Grid; +import com.vaadin.flow.component.html.Span; +import com.vaadin.flow.component.orderedlayout.FlexLayout; +import com.vaadin.flow.component.orderedlayout.HorizontalLayout; +import com.vaadin.flow.component.orderedlayout.VerticalLayout; +import com.vaadin.flow.component.textfield.TextArea; +import com.vaadin.flow.component.textfield.TextField; import com.vaadin.flow.router.PageTitle; import com.vaadin.flow.router.Route; +import com.vaadin.flow.theme.lumo.LumoUtility; import jakarta.annotation.security.PermitAll; +import org.checkerframework.checker.units.qual.A; + +import java.util.Collections; @PermitAll @PageTitle("Home") -@Route(value = "/", layout = MainLayout.class) -public class ActDiariaView { +@Route(value = "actdiaria", layout = MainLayout.class) +public class ActDiariaView extends VerticalLayout { + + //Variables Locales + HorizontalLayout header = new HorizontalLayout(); + + + public ActDiariaView() { + + Span etiqueta = new Span("Listado de tividades"); + + FormLayout formLayout=new FormLayout(); + FlexLayout flexLayout = new FlexLayout(); + + etiqueta.setWidth(100, Unit.PERCENTAGE); + + flexLayout.setMaxWidth(100, Unit.PERCENTAGE); + flexLayout.setWidth("100%"); + flexLayout.getElement().getStyle().set("background-color","red"); + flexLayout.getElement().getStyle().set("border-radius", LumoUtility.BorderRadius.LARGE); + + header.setSizeUndefined(); + header.setFlexGrow(1,etiqueta); + header.add(etiqueta); + header.getElement().getStyle().set("background-color","green"); + + formLayout.add(header); + formLayout.setSizeUndefined(); + + flexLayout.add(Collections.singleton(formLayout)); + + + add(flexLayout); + + //Tabla echa con un grid - public ActDiariaView() { } -} +} \ No newline at end of file diff --git a/src/main/java/mx/gob/jumapacelaya/ui/MainLayout.java b/src/main/java/mx/gob/jumapacelaya/ui/MainLayout.java index 5081f19..92a4170 100644 --- a/src/main/java/mx/gob/jumapacelaya/ui/MainLayout.java +++ b/src/main/java/mx/gob/jumapacelaya/ui/MainLayout.java @@ -77,7 +77,7 @@ public class MainLayout extends AppLayout { SideNav nav = new SideNav(); nav.addItem(new SideNavItem("Mantenimiento", MantenimientoView.class, VaadinIcon.COGS.create())); - // nav.addItem(new SideNavItem("Actividad Diaria", ActDiariaView.class, VaadinIcon.ALARM.create())); + nav.addItem(new SideNavItem("Actividad Diaria", ActDiariaView.class, VaadinIcon.ALARM.create())); return nav; }